About This Property

This terraced maisonette is located in NOTTINGHAM, NG2 1PJ. The property offers 76m² (818 sq ft) of modest-sized living space with 3 habitable rooms. It is built during the 1980s construction period. The property holds an EPC rating of C (75/100), meeting the government's target standard for energy efficiency. The gas central heating system has good efficiency, indicating a relatively modern, well-maintained boiler. The property has good loft insulation, though topping up to the recommended 270mm depth could provide additional energy savings. Double glazing is installed throughout the property, providing good thermal and acoustic insulation. Estimated annual energy costs are £728, comprising £504 for heating, £139 for hot water, and £85 for lighting. The property produces 2.1 tonnes of CO2 per year, which is low for a UK home.

About school ratings: Ofsted ratings range from Outstanding to Inadequate. These ratings are based on inspections of teaching quality, leadership, pupil behavior, and safety. Note that school catchment areas vary - check with the school or local council for admission details.

What do these speeds mean? 10-30 Mbps: Good for browsing and streaming. 30-100 Mbps: Great for multiple users and HD streaming. 100-300 Mbps: Excellent for 4K streaming and gaming. 300+ Mbps: Perfect for large households and heavy internet use.

About this EPC: Energy Performance Certificates are valid for 10 years and are required when a property is built, sold, or rented. Learn more about EPCs or book an EPC assessment.
